At revival time, your driving document is checked to see if you have any kind of offenses now noted that would certainly trigger your rates to increase or for your policy to be non-renewed. If you have offenses on your driving record that have diminished, your rates must decrease when Helpful site your plan renews. The factors will certainly go on your driving record and remain for assigned time periods. The amount of time is determined by your state and by the type of infraction. The even more points you get, the most likely you are to have your certificate suspended or revoked, and the higher the risk you are to an automobile insurance provider.
